| 04.04.2019 New hedge funds are significantly raising minimum investment levels: Study |
| Matthias Knab, Opalesque: Minimum investment amounts required by newly launched funds have skyrocketed as new managers are seeking out more start-up capital to counteract their rising bills, said the 'Seward & Kissel 2018 New Hedge Fund Study'.
